Abstract :
The transverse momentum discriminator module (PTDM) is one of the three main modules used in the level 1 charged particle trigger system of the BABAR detector at PEP-II. It provides trigger decisions for charged particles with a transverse momentum, Pt, greater than a configurable threshold. The transverse momentum discrimination algorithm works by evaluating the curvature of the charged tracks in the 1.5 T axial magnetic field. The capabilities of the PTDM are key to a stable and efficient operation of the BABAR experiment even under severe background conditions
